Like walking into a little piece of Thailand, Thaikhun restaurants have transported the entire Thai street food market experience to the UK. Owned jointly by Kim Kaewkraitkhot and Martin Stead, Thaikhun is inspired by Kim's stories of running her own small restaurant in Bangkok. Kim's food was renowned by locals for it's fantastic flavours, especially her award-winning Phad Thai recipe. 2014 saw the first Thaikhun open introducing Thai street food to the city of Manchester. Thaikhun has been welcomed with open arms and now is home to restaurants all across the UK, including Aberdeen, Glasgow, Oxford, Cambridge, Nottingham, Newcastle, Guildford, Bath and Southampton. Throughout Thaikhun journey, we have held our four core values of 'Ow Jai Sai' (caring from the heart), 'Samakee' (togetherness), 'Ha Dao' (To give 5 star service) and mostly importantly, 'Sanook' (To have fun) close to our heart investing time and care into our team and their training.
